WednesdayToday Dr. Cobb reflects on Romans 8, where St. Paul reminds us that nothing can separate us from the love of God in Christ Jesus. At times we may feel overwhelmed by worry, fear, anxiety, or pain. We may even feel distant from God. But Paul proclaims a deeper truth: no suffering, no failure, no fear, no darkness can cut us off from God’s love. This meditation invites us to surrender our anxieties and allow Jesus to heal the places in us that feel separated or alone.
